Separation of powers tested as court halts MP Kibagendi House suspension

High Court has suspended Moses Wetang’ula’s indefinite ban of the MP...
✨ Key Highlights
A Kenyan court has halted the suspension of Kitutu Chache South Member of Parliament Anthony Kibagendi, reinstating him after his remarks on Parliament's independence led to his ban from House sittings.
- The court issued conservatory orders on Thursday, March 19, 2026, suspending an February 17 resolution by the National Assembly.
- Key figures involved include MP Anthony Kibagendi and the National Assembly's Speaker.
- The ruling affirmed that the doctrine of separation of powers does not exempt Parliament from judicial scrutiny, emphasizing that the Constitution binds all institutions.
